Output d999bf3b68841729b13e5629b3a4524c7093466ce9a8bfe3ed6b97c113a94d8f:1

value
803902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a631ca1a4e6c0ba390c10baf5ef4f9d14c1750 OP_EQUAL
address
2MwbAqhJEESJYrrnLNuaPGksUddD2Aap33c
transaction
d999bf3b68841729b13e5629b3a4524c7093466ce9a8bfe3ed6b97c113a94d8f
confirmations
108960
spent
true